The Emfuleni native municipality within the Vaal, is asking on residents to dispose-off waste at municipal amenities, following the collapse of assortment companies.
In an announcement, the municipality says that previously week, it has not been capable of accumulate family waste as scheduled.
This is because of their waste division having a restricted variety of compactor vehicles in operation, which has affected service supply.
The municipality has attributed this collapse to the attachment of their checking account in addition to 9 compactor vehicles by the Sheriff.
The Democratic Alliance (DA) in Gauteng says it’s outraged that the Emfuleni Native Municipality has uncared for to take away trash for 4 weeks in a row, forcing residents to dwell in unhygienic and unhealthy situations.
In an announcement, the DA says this failure of service supply exposes the lie that the African Nationwide Congress (ANC) in authorities cares concerning the dignity of South Africans.
“It’s alleged that the reason for the present disastrous state of affairs is because of the Sheriff seizing property, together with refuse vehicles, from the Emfuleni Native Municipality places of work in Vanderbijlpark resulting from non-payment of a R5.8 billion debt to Eskom.”
